AdmissionsOS | Baker College | Hope College | |
|---|---|---|
| Acceptance rate lower = more selective | 82% | 79% |
| SAT range (mid 50%) | 960-1,160 | 1,100-1,340 |
| ACT range (mid 50%) | n/a | 25-31 |
| Average net price what students actually pay after aid | $13,157 | $27,182 |
| Sticker cost of attendance | $24,526 | $55,646 |
| Graduation rate | 36% | 80% |
| Retention rate | 66% | 88% |
| Undergraduates | 3,026 | 3,288 |
| Student-faculty ratio | 9:1 | 9:1 |
| Setting | Owosso, MI | Holland, MI |
| Type | Private nonprofit | Private nonprofit |
| Application fee | None | None |
| Test policy | Test-optional | Test-optional |
Highlighted values mark the stronger figure on cost and outcomes. Verified for the 2025-2026 cycle.

Baker College has the lower average net price ($13,157 versus $27,182). Net price is what families actually pay after grants and scholarships, so it is a truer comparison than sticker price. Run each school's net price calculator for your own income.
